PUBLIC SWIMMING POOL

FREEDOM WATER

SWIMMING IN THE OCEAN IS

BETTER THAN SWIMMING IN A

PUBLIC POOL.

I agree with your statement, I strongly believe that the feeling of
freedom and tranquillity that the ocean gives are unimaginable. In the
ocean, the water flows, it does not remain stagnant, it has movement, it
changes constantly. Apart from that if we touch on the health issue, I am
completely sure that both the chlorine they use to disinfect the pool
water, and the microorganisms that are found there they are dangerous to
health, some of the examples that we can mention is that the diseases
transmitted by these waters include infections at level gastrointestinal,
respiratory, on ears, and eyes, in my view this makes them have more
disadvantages. Although, public swimming pools are safer, generally the
number of people who use it at the same time is extremely high and
therefore their maintenance is not permanent. On the other hand, I would
say that in pools you cannot swim on a big area, instead in the ocean you
can enjoy the ecosystems that can be found there, you can swim to great
depths, the expectation of what you are going to observe is so great. Finally,
In my honest opinion I think that swimming in the ocean is much better,
the only thing to keep in mind is that in the ocean you will find a large
number of animals that deserve all your consideration and respect, from
my point of view they are the owners of those and if you are going to
enter on their space, you must take into account the measures to not affect
them.
